下面是我的数据日期 数据20210509 1000 2614 20220902 1000 2411 20220903 1000 2662 20220903 1000 2556 20220904 0800 2556 20220905 0800 2537 20220906 0800 20220908 0800 2901 20220915 0800 2904 20220
根据您提供的代码,knn补充的地方为空白的原因可能是以下几点:
-
数据不满足KNN算法的要求:KNN算法需要根据数据的相似性来进行填充,如果数据之间的相似性较低或者没有足够的参考数据,可能无法进行有效的填充。
-
数据格式不匹配:在代码中,通过判断单元格的类型来进行数据的填充。如果数据的格式与代码中的判断条件不匹配,可能导致填充失败或者填充结果不正确。
-
数据处理逻辑问题:在代码中,使用calculateKNN方法计算KNN填充的值。可能存在数据处理逻辑上的问题,导致填充结果不正确。
建议您检查以上几点,确认数据的格式和逻辑是否正确,并根据具体情况进行调整和修正。
原文地址: https://www.cveoy.top/t/topic/hUMk 著作权归作者所有。请勿转载和采集!